The book of 1 Timothy, one of the Apostle Paul's three Pastoral Epistles, provides a unique yardstick for churches to measure their conduct. The letter identifies the traits of committed Christians and also offers practical and spiritual guidance to pastors and church leaders. WebNov 24, 2008 · 1 Tim. 2:12 refers to a wife and husband. Another argument offered concerning 1 Tim. 2:12 is to say that the Greek words “gyne” (woman) and “andros” (man) mean wife and husband. This would render the verse as, “But I do not allow a wife to teach or exercise authority over a husband, but to remain quiet.” ( 1 Tim. 2:12 ). WebTimothy, Titus, and Silas all appear in the New Testament writings as missionary companions of, and co-workers with, the Apostle Paul.. Silas (aka Silvanus) accompanied Paul through Asia Minor and Greece, and was imprisoned with him at Philippi (Acts 15:22-18:5), where they were delivered by an earthquake. WebNov 18, 2024 · Timothy, is the recipient of the two New Testament letters bearing his name. Paul writes to him as though he was physically weak maybe due to his missionary work (1 Tim. 5:23). Timothy was tried with difficulties that caused him pain (2 Tim. 1:4), but Paul asked the churches to support him as he worked for the Lord (1 Cor. 16:10).

The Parish of St. Timothy was founded in 1958 to meet the needs of 450 families in West Hartford, CT. Its first pastor, the late Reverend Francis O’Neill, guided it for the first 30 years.
